Our group of four booked this cruise close to sailing for a nice getaway. I have been on 25+ cruises. I read the reviews and do not think that the reviews do it justice. The ship is lovely. It is designed in a way that you never feel crowded. The staff of this ship are personable, kind and helpful. The food was amazing, top of the line. Our inside cabin had more room than most plus a refrigerator. Quiet location, Baja deck, next to the elevators. The entertainment that we attended was very good. We did our own shore excursions but the stops at ABC islands with 4 sea days was a nice mix of busy and relaxation.

The only down side was that I ingested something in my gin and tonic drink that has given me problems ever since. From what I have figured out with the help of the cruise staff, is that the ice comes attached to clear plastic in containers. Sometimes, the plastic sticks to the ice. The ice melts in the drink, the clear plastic is in the drink but you can't see it and unfortunately I ended up with it. I was told it has happened before from the staff. I had to seek medical attention and ended up in the hospital for my throat pain. Be careful with your drinks! Only reason for an overall 4 rating not a 5.

Cabin Review

Interior

For an inside room, lots more room than I expected in the cabin and bathroom. Big open closet a plus. Refrigerator a plus. Quiet location on Baja deck 11 next to aft elevators.
